Worked example: Software contractor, 44, £220,000 of contract value
Picture a software contractor aged 44 for the 2026/27 tax year, on an inside-IR35 umbrella contract billing £1,000 per day for 220 days. The optimisation goal for this profile is maximum net wealth (treating £1 of pension as £1 of cash today).
Running the engine for this exact profile:
- Day rate: £1,000 (220 billable days)
- Contract value: £220,000
- Net cash to the contractor: £98,266
- Pension via salary sacrifice: £33,000
- Total deductions through the chain: £88,734 (40.3% effective on contract value)
- Break-even outside-IR35 day rate: £1,067/day
